Six children and two adults were lucky to walk away from a two car collision at Unanderra early on Sunday afternoon.

Shortly after 1pm emergency services were called to the corner of Nolan Street and the Princes Highway Unanderra where two vehicles collided heavily. It is understood the impact resulted in one vehicle eventually coming to rest on top of the bonnet of the other.
Ambulance NSW Illawarra district officer Inspector Terry Morrow said four ambulances were despatched to the accident as initial reports suggested the six children and two female drivers were all injured. However he said upon arrival and assessment of those involved in the accident, not all the ambulances were required.
“We transported two adult females and one young child to Wollongong Hospital,” Insp Morrow said.
“The impact from the collision caused seatbelt and air-bag injuries.”
